接口测试自动化策略(实现快速准确的接口检验)

网友投稿 158 2024-01-22


随着软件开发的日益复杂和系统之间的集成愈发紧密,接口测试在软件测试中的重要性与日俱增。而接口测试自动化策略,作为一种高效、可靠的测试方法,成为了提高生产效率和质量的关键。通过使用自动化技术,可以实现快速准确的接口检验。


为了实现快速准确的接口检验,以下是一些接口测试自动化策略的关键步骤:


1. 确定测试目标和范围


在开始接口测试自动化之前,首先需要确定测试目标和范围。明确要测试的接口类型、功能和性能要求,以及需要覆盖的业务场景。这有助于确保测试的深度和广度,并为后续的测试工作提供方向。


2. 选择合适的自动化工具


选择合适的自动化测试工具是接口测试自动化的关键。根据项目需求和技术栈的不同,可以选择不同的工具来进行接口测试自动化。常见的接口测试自动化工具包括Postman、SoapUI、JMeter等。这些工具提供了丰富的功能和易于使用的界面,使得接口测试自动化更加便捷。


3. 编写测试脚本


编写测试脚本是接口测试自动化的核心步骤。通过使用自动化工具提供的脚本语言或者录制功能,可以编写和生成用于测试的脚本。测试脚本可以模拟用户请求,验证接口的请求和响应数据。编写良好的测试脚本,可以提高测试的可维护性和重复使用性。


4. 参数化和数据驱动


在接口测试中,参数化和数据驱动是实现快速准确的接口检验的重要策略。通过参数化,可以将测试脚本中的固定值替换成可变的参数。通过数据驱动,可以使用不同的数据源来驱动测试,并验证接口在不同数据条件下的表现。这样可以增加测试的覆盖率,并提高测试效率。


5. 执行测试并生成报告


执行接口测试脚本,并生成测试报告是接口测试自动化的最终步骤。通过自动化工具,可以批量执行测试脚本,并自动生成执行结果和统计数据。测试报告提供了对接口测试覆盖率、成功率和性能情况的全面分析,帮助开发团队快速定位和解决问题。


综上所述,接口测试自动化策略是实现快速准确的接口检验的关键。通过明确测试目标和范围、选择合适的自动化工具、编写测试脚本、参数化和数据驱动,以及执行测试并生成报告,可以提高接口测试的效率和质量,确保软件系统的稳定性和可靠性。


版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:接口自动化(提升测试效率的关键技术)
下一篇:数据库接口管理平台的技术架构与性能优化(分析数据库接口管理平台的技术架构及性能优化方法)
相关文章

 发表评论

暂时没有评论,来抢沙发吧~